Web27 jan. 2015 · In either case, each square has three significant figures, so we round each to three sig figs, getting x = 20.8 + 1.51 Next we add one decimal place to two decimal places, giving one decimal place. x = 22.3 Finally we take the square root of three significant figures, giving three sig figs. x = 4.72 Is all that clear?
